FAQ About Bali Leasehold Villa Sales
Everything you need to know before buying a villa in Bali — ownership, process, costs and returns.
How to buy a leasehold property in Bali?
Contact a reputable real estate agency or lawyer specializing in Bali property. Identify suitable properties and negotiate terms with the landlord. Draft and sign a lease agreement outlining the terms and conditions of the leasehold.
How much is a leasehold in Bali?
Leasehold prices in Bali vary depending on factors such as location, property size, and amenities. Prices can range from a few hundred thousand dollars to several million, depending on the property’s specifications.
How much does it cost to lease a villa in Bali?
The cost of leasing a villa in Bali depends on various factors such as location, size, amenities, and lease duration. Monthly lease rates can range from a few hundred dollars to several thousand, with long-term leases typically offering better value.
Can foreigners buy leasehold property in Bali?
Yes, foreigners can buy leasehold property in Bali. However, they cannot own land outright and must lease it from the Indonesian landowner. Read more on the Law & regulations in Indonesia.
What happens at the end of a leasehold in Bali?
At the end of the leasehold period, the property reverts to the landowner unless a renewal or extension is negotiated beforehand.
What are the disadvantages of buying leasehold?
Limited control over the property as ownership rights remain with the landowner. Potential uncertainty regarding lease renewal terms and conditions. Less flexibility compared to freehold ownership.
Can you sell leasehold property in Bali?
Yes, leasehold property in Bali can be sold, provided the terms of the lease agreement allow for resale.
How does leasehold work in Bali?
Leasehold in Bali involves leasing land or property from the Indonesian landowner for a set period, typically 25 to 30 years, with the option to renew.
How long is leasehold in Bali?
Leasehold periods in Bali commonly range from 25 to 30 years, with the possibility of extension or renewal.
What is the difference between freehold and leasehold in Bali?
Freehold ownership grants full ownership rights to the property and land indefinitely. Leasehold ownership involves leasing the property or land from the landowner for a set period, typically 25 to 30 years, with the option to renew.
